As a youth, Katherine Hines felt God's calling on her life to minister to orphans and was drawn to the country of Uganda. She took the opportunity to visit the country in June 1994. She traveled alone under arrangement with The Africa Christian Training Institute, whom she found through the Urbana Mission Conference in 1990. The village of Kamonkoli (in eastern Uganda) particularly touched her heart and she found that there were few mission agencies serving this area. Again, in July of 1995 Katherine returned to Kamonkoli to minister to the orphans and widows of the community. She officially founded Hines Ugandan Ministries (HUM) in 1999 and continues to serve the village as the Lord leads her and blesses the ministry. The HUM staff, consisting of local believers, assists Katherine in ministering Christ’s love to their community.
